3-star jungle wellness resort in Belize with on-site helicopter access
Amenities & Grounds
The resort has 2 outdoor pools, a hot tub, and a spa with full-body massages, body scrubs, and Ayurvedic treatments. Guests can use the fitness centre, borrow bicycles, or take walking tours and hiking trails on the property. The grounds include a chapel, a shared lounge with TV, and a garden with outdoor furniture and sun terraces.
Rooms
Each room is individually decorated with jungle-themed decor and includes a flat-screen TV, purified water, and a private bathroom with a shower, bathrobe, and slippers. Room types range from Standard Rooms to Junior Suites and two-bedroom Signature Villas. All accommodations are allergy-free, have key access, and daily housekeeping is provided.
Location & Transportation
The resort is located in the jungle outside Maskall Village, 30 miles from Belize International Airport and a 50-minute drive from the Lamanai Maya ruins dock. The property has an on-site helicopter for guest tours and offers airport pickup, airport drop-off, and shuttle service. Parking includes accessible spaces and an electric vehicle charging station.
Wellness & Spa
The spa offers couples massage, hot stone treatments, facials, manicures, pedicures, and a mood mud massage that includes an open-air bath. Spa packages cover body wraps, full-body massage, foot massage, and neck massage. The spa has a relaxation lounge, locker rooms, and a 24-hour heated mineral bath on the property.
Dining
Food is made to order from locally sourced organic ingredients, with daily chef specials and a menu that includes fruits, wine, champagne, and special diet menus. Breakfast can be served in the room, and packed lunches are available for excursions. The on-site bar and restaurant serve breakfast, lunch, and dinner with a focus on Belizean cuisine.

What are the costs associated with the airport shuttle, and can arrangements be made for a day trip to Altun Ha?
12 November 2024
The round trip land transfer from Philip S.W. Goldson International Airport (BZE) costs $135 USD (tax included) for 1-2 people. A one-way transfer is available for $67.50 USD. Day trips to Altun Ha can be arranged for resort guests. Simply provide your dates, and all necessary arrangements will be taken care of.
Is this resort recognized as a Gold Standard establishment?
20 September 2024
Yes, the resort holds Gold Standard certification, ensuring it meets the highest safety and sanitation standards. Additionally, it operates as a licensed Gold Standard Tour Operator.
